1994 Lancia Kappa vs. 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S

To start off, 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Lancia Kappa.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Lancia Kappa would be higher. At 4,719 cc (8 cylinders), 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S (655 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 480 more horse power than 1994 Lancia Kappa. (175 HP @ 6100 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S should accelerate faster than 1994 Lancia Kappa.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1994 Lancia Kappa weights approximately 275 kg more than 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S.

Because 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Lancia Kappa,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S (752 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 522 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Lancia Kappa. (230 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Lancia Kappa.

Compare all specifications:

1994 Lancia Kappa 2002 Koenigsegg CC8S
Make Lancia Koenigsegg
Model Kappa CC8S
Year Released 1994 2002
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 2446 cc 4719 cc
Engine Cylinders 5 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 175 HP 655 HP
Engine RPM 6100 RPM 6500 RPM
Torque 230 Nm 752 Nm
Torque RPM 3750 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 10.0:1 8.6:1
Top Speed 214 km/hour 389 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 9.2 seconds 3.6 seconds
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1450 kg 1175 kg
Vehicle Length 4690 mm 4191 mm
Vehicle Width 1870 mm 1989 mm
Vehicle Height 1470 mm 1069 mm
Wheelbase Size 2710 mm 2659 mm
